Before changing lilo to reflect any memory config, in a terminal window,
type: cat /proc/meminfo
If the mem total indicates less RAM than you have installed, than you need
to edit lilo. If the mem total reflects the correct amount of memory, don't
touch anything.
If you do need to edit lilo, use your choice terminal editor, vi work fine.
The file is: /etc/lilo.conf
insert, at the very beginning, the following line, including the quotation
marks:
append="mem=128M"
Save the file, exit, and typr /sbin/lilo
You should see at least one line, possibly more:
Added linux*
Added failsafe
The asterisk indicates the default boot option.
